xDot Access Management System Pivotal Study

Starting soon ·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Vascular Closure Devices

In brief

The objective of this study is to establish reasonable assurance of safety and effectiveness for the xDot Access Management System (AMS) when used as indicated for femoral-arterial and femoral-venous closure. Additionally, this study will provide preliminary evidence on the impact on health outcomes for patients undergoing interventional catheterization procedures when the xDot AMS is used for vascular closure.
